Transaction 7eca20b36136aeaf4989b91f5205b0b9d7d90de6f720a6c5956e84d722626439

17 Input
2 Outputs
  • 7eca20b36136aeaf4989b91f5205b0b9d7d90de6f720a6c5956e84d722626439:0
  • value  1710407
    address  1N3HsYs6HHz9ZMcjGPisBsytntGfTDnahW
  • 7eca20b36136aeaf4989b91f5205b0b9d7d90de6f720a6c5956e84d722626439:1
  • value  2288882251
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s